Where to Use With Caution
While the Oktober Fest Quote Retro Svg Design is impressive in many ways, there are scenarios where it might need careful handling:
- Small Hoop Sizes: The design’s layout may require resizing, which could affect readability and clarity of the smaller elements.
- Textured Fabrics: If you're working with denim, flannel, or other thick materials, consider adjusting stitch density to avoid puckering.
- Stretchy or Thin Fabrics: These can cause distortion or loss of definition, especially in areas with tight curves or corners.
- Dark Fabric Backgrounds: Thread color choices become more critical here. Light threads on dark backgrounds can sometimes appear washed out or lack depth.
- Curved Surfaces: For items like caps or curved patches, the design should be tested for alignment and deformation after stitching.
- Dense Stitch Areas: Some parts of the design have heavier stitch coverage, so be mindful of possible tension issues or bulkiness.
- Products That Need Frequent Washing: While the design holds up well initially, frequent laundering could cause fading or loosening of threads depending on the garment type and care instructions.
Testing Tips for Best Results
Before committing to a full production run or client order, I recommend doing a few test runs. Here’s what I did:
- Printed a printable mockup to get a better sense of how it would look on different products.
- Tested it on scrap fabric in various colors to see how thread contrast affected visibility.
- Checked stitch density settings to ensure no unnecessary bunching or thin spots.
- Used a medium-weight stabilizer to support the design during sewing, especially on stretchier materials.
